The Thrill of LaLiga Matches: Tactics and Talent
LaLiga's distinct flavour comes from its emphasis on technical skill, intricate passing, and fluid attacking play. While other leagues might prioritize physicality, Spanish football often showcases a balletic approach, where possession, quick one-touch passes, and individual flair reign supreme. Teams meticulously craft build-up play, often working the ball through midfield with patience before unleashing devastating attacks. The "tiki-taka" style, famously perfected by Barcelona, is a testament to this philosophy, influencing countless teams across the division.
Beyond the tactical masterclasses, LaLiga is a crucible for some of the world's most gifted footballers. Historically, it has been home to legends like Lionel Messi, Cristiano Ronaldo, and Zinedine Zidane. Today, stars such as Vinicius Jr., Robert Lewandowski, Antoine Griezmann, and Jude Bellingham continue to light up the pitches with their sublime abilities. These players, often products of renowned youth academies, bring an unparalleled level of skill, vision, and athleticism to every game, ensuring that moments of magic are never far away. The blend of seasoned veterans and exciting young prospects creates a dynamic league where every team possesses the potential for brilliance. The tactical battles between coaches, each with their distinct philosophies, add another layer of intrigue, making every game a chess match played out on grass.
Key Rivalries and Iconic Fixtures
No discussion of LaLiga games is complete without acknowledging its fierce rivalries. These aren't just football matches; they are cultural events steeped in history, regional pride, and intense emotion.
The undisputed king of these clashes is El Clásico, the monumental showdown between Real Madrid and FC Barcelona. This fixture transcends football, often reflecting political and cultural divides within Spain. It pits two of the world's wealthiest and most successful clubs against each other, featuring an array of global superstars and a history of breathtaking goals and dramatic finishes. The atmosphere, whether at the Santiago Bernabéu or Camp Nou, is electric, making it a must-watch event for any football enthusiast. Recent encounters have continued to deliver drama, with both teams consistently battling for supremacy at the top of the league.
Beyond El Clásico, other regional derbies ignite immense passion. The Madrid Derby between Real Madrid and Atlético Madrid is a gritty, tactical affair, often characterized by Diego Simeone's defensive masterclass against Real's attacking prowess. In Andalusia, the Sevilla Derby between Sevilla FC and Real Betis Balompié is a vibrant, colourful contest where local bragging rights are fiercely contested. These games, while perhaps not receiving the global attention of El Clásico, are equally important to their respective fan bases, showcasing the deep-rooted passion that defines Spanish football.
How to Watch LaLiga Games: Streaming and Experience
Catching LaLiga games has never been easier, thanks to a variety of broadcasting and streaming options available globally. In many regions, major sports networks hold exclusive rights to broadcast matches, offering comprehensive coverage, expert analysis, and often pre and post-match shows.
For those looking for flexibility, official streaming services provide access to all fixtures live and on-demand. Platforms like ESPN+ in the USA, Viaplay in the UK, or DAZN in other territories often carry the full LaLiga season. Always check your local sports broadcaster or official league website for the most accurate information on where to watch in your specific region. Many of these services offer subscription models, allowing fans to enjoy every moment of the season from their devices.
